- tbalsam 3y agoStart with 7B and refine as much as you possibly can there. Your value is going to be determined by the variable iteration_time, where your final equation involves 1/iteration_time. Any lessons learned there will effectively scale. When you cannot get any improvements over several days/weeks of different experiments and have converged somewhat, then move up to the next model size, and do that to convergence. Then repeat this loop as you go. Same concept as mipmapping, just with resources. How you use your resources is more important than the ones you have. I've made the vast majority of my own big discoveries with a T4 or a single A100, generally speaking, and I've done this for years. In terms of providers, I like Lambda the best, personally, but I do a shocking amount of work in Colab Pro due to its iterative nature. I believe I've had GPU availability issues for both of them, however.
